How compatibility with GPS, BeiDou, GLONASS, and Galileo boosts UAV navigation
Drones count heavily on uninterrupted and accurate satellite signals to take care of stable flight paths and realize specific positioning. The UBX-M9140 GNSS module, or ubx-m9140-kb, supports 4 major satellite constellations: GPS, BeiDou, GLONASS, and Galileo. This broad compatibility lets it to obtain concurrent signals from various navigation networks, which appreciably improves sign availability and positional accuracy throughout flight. In urban canyons or mountainous areas, where sign blockage or multipath results frequently disrupt single-constellation receivers, the ubx-m9140-kb's multi-process method compensates by switching or combining facts streams. This makes sure consistent area updates, facilitating smoother UAV operations. The module's industrial-grade style and design, crafted to deal with demanding environments, also resists interference and jamming makes an attempt, further more enhancing navigation dependability. advantages of high update frequency and positioning accuracy for flight Command
preserving exact Handle above drone flight frequently depends upon how swiftly and correctly positioning facts might be processed. The ubx-m9140-kb module addresses this by featuring posture update frequencies around 25Hz, which implies it refreshes location information twenty-five instances for each next. This rapid cadence will allow flight controllers to respond quickly to environmental modifications or navigational changes, bringing about smoother maneuvering and heightened security for the duration of superior-velocity operations or intricate flight paths. In addition, the horizontal accuracy made available from the UBX-M9140 GNSS module, about one.5 meters with SBAS augmentation, offers dependable spatial recognition essential for sensitive tasks for instance aerial pictures or information mapping. The precision at which this module detects velocity alterations - having an precision close to 0.5 m/s - even more aids in preserving responsive Management, critical during autonomous or semi-autonomous flights. These general performance qualities make the ubx-m9140-kb specifically compatible to drone programs requiring stringent navigation requirements and fast knowledge responsiveness.
Integration capabilities fitted to drones and flight Command GPS modules
Seamless integration is crucial for drone techniques, in which measurement, electrical power usage, and interface compatibility influence General performance. The UBX-M9140 GNSS module excels in these factors with its compact dimensions and modest excess weight, which assistance maintain UAV payloads mild and aerodynamic. functioning over a Functioning voltage that matches inside common drone electrical power provide constraints and consuming fewer than 100mW, the ubx-m9140-kb proves Vitality-economical, So preserving battery lifetime all through extended flights. Its interaction setup uses a two.54mm pin socket interface which has a default baud fee conducive to clean info transmission following popular protocols like NMEA0183. Furthermore, modular antenna solutions for example IPEX, SMA, and Other individuals enhance adaptability to diverse drone models and demands without sacrificing signal energy. The enhanced components filtering and small sound amplifier integrated into the device guard in opposition to RF interference, a Regular problem in drone functions laden with multiple radio techniques. constructed for industrial-quality toughness, the UBX-M9140 GNSS module, much like DALANG GNSS RTK Modules, encourages straightforward integration into sophisticated flight Manage GPS modules, giving a solid foundation for specific UAV navigation.
